The other day I did a little Google research on this matter. I am not the only grown lady with this problem--so I was able to get some excellent answers and/or advice.
Women, like me, have had good success with a high stretch to cotton ratio.
And I learned/read to try on all jeans, even if it's the same brand and cut/style.
